An Executive Certificate in Conflict Management is increasingly significant for agricultural professionals in the UK. The sector faces growing pressures: land scarcity, climate change, and Brexit have intensified competition and created friction among stakeholders. According to the NFU, dispute resolution costs the UK agricultural industry an estimated £100 million annually.

Dispute Type Estimated Cost (£m)
Land Boundaries 30
Tenancy Agreements 25
Environmental Regulations 20
Supply Chain Issues 25

This certificate equips professionals with crucial skills in negotiation, mediation, and arbitration, enabling them to effectively manage conflicts and avoid costly legal battles. Mastering these conflict resolution techniques is vital for navigating complex relationships within the agricultural value chain, fostering collaboration, and ensuring business sustainability. The ability to prevent and resolve conflicts is a highly sought-after skill, making graduates highly competitive in the modern agricultural market.
